How to Prepare & Consume
Blend fresh raspberries with oat milk and ice for a refreshing smoothie. Optionally, add a sweetener like honey or maple syrup.
Smart Selection & Storage
Choose ripe raspberries that are firm and plump, avoiding any that are mushy or moldy. For oat milk, look for unsweetened varieties with minimal additives.
Store raspberries in the refrigerator and consume them within a few days. Oat milk should be refrigerated and consumed before the expiration date.

Raspberry Oat Milk Smoothie Bowl
A vibrant smoothie bowl topped with fresh fruits and seeds, perfect for a nutritious breakfast or snack.
- 1 cup Detoxing Raspberry Oat Milk Smoothie
- 1 banana, sliced
- 1/4 cup granola
- 1 tablespoon chia seeds
- 1/4 cup mixed berries
- 1. Blend the Detoxing Raspberry Oat Milk Smoothie until smooth.
- 2. Pour the smoothie into a bowl and arrange the banana slices, granola, chia seeds, and mixed berries on top.
- 3. Serve immediately and enjoy with a spoon.

Raspberry Oat Milk Chia Pudding
A delightful chia pudding infused with raspberry oat milk, perfect for a healthy dessert or snack.
- 1 cup Detoxing Raspberry Oat Milk Smoothie
- 1/4 cup chia seeds
- 1 tablespoon honey
- 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1. In a bowl, mix the Detoxing Raspberry Oat Milk Smoothie, chia seeds, honey, and vanilla extract.
- 2. Stir well and let it sit for 10 minutes, then stir again to prevent clumping.
- 3. Refrigerate for at least 2 hours or overnight, and serve chilled.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Can I use frozen raspberries?
Yes, frozen raspberries work well and can make your smoothie colder and thicker.
Is this smoothie suitable for vegans?
Absolutely! Oat milk is a plant-based alternative, making this smoothie vegan-friendly.
How can I make it sweeter?
You can add honey, agave syrup, or a ripe banana for natural sweetness.
Can I add protein powder?
Yes, adding a scoop of protein powder can enhance the nutritional profile.
Is it gluten-free?
Yes, as long as you use certified gluten-free oats.
How long can I store it?
It's best consumed fresh, but you can store it in the fridge for up to 24 hours.
Can I add other fruits?
Definitely! Bananas, strawberries, or blueberries can be great additions.
What are the health benefits of oat milk?
Oat milk is rich in fiber and can help lower cholesterol levels while being low in saturated fat.
